The Independent Association of Young Entrepreneurs of Catalonia (AIJEC) has awarded the Award for the Best Business Initiative of its 25th edition to Peptomyc.
Peptomyc is a spin-off of the Vall d’Hebron Institute of Oncology founded in 2014 by Doctors Laura Soucek and Marie-Eve Beaulieu and dedicated to the development of a new therapy against cancer. The company focuses on developing peptides against Myc for the treatment of certain cancers of the lung and breast, as well as against the brain tumor. The jury has assessed the benefits that this technology can bring to the society and how the statistics can be turned around, doubling the survival of the patients.
Since its founding, Peptomyc has been awarded with numerous prizes in national and international startup competitions, such as the EntrepreneurXXI Award in Catalonia, which Peptomyc won last March.
